Kubernetes Platform as a Service in the public cloud

De Novo's Kubernetes as a Service (KaaS) is a modern platform for orchestrating industrial-grade Kubernetes clusters in the public cloud.

The basis of KaaS is the technological stack of VMware Tanzu Kubernetes Grid (TKG) and Cloud Director Container Services Extension, which allows you to manage the full life cycle of K8s clusters directly from the graphical interface of the cloud operational portal of the Cloud Director or through the vCD API (using, for example, terraform). KaaS seamlessly coexists and integrates with "conventional" (IaaS) virtual data centers in Cloud Director.

The functionality and usability of KaaS is similar to "managed Kubernetes" class services from hyperscalers (AWS Elastic Kubernetes Services, Google Kubernetes Engine, MS Azure Kubernetes Services).

Key values of KaaS

A distribution of unmodified Kubernetes (no proprietary, no vendor lock), prepared, verified, signed and kept up to date by VMware. Tanzu Kubernetes Grid is certified for interoperability by the Cloud Native Computing Foundation (CNCF). The procedure for updating K8s clusters is fully automated and is performed without stopping services (rolling upgrade).

Deep and core integration with the basic IaaS infrastructure. This allows you to consume its resources (auth, computing, storage, network) as efficiently as possible (without unnecessary software layers) and standard (CSI, CNI, CPI, GPU-operator) means without the need to know the details of its construction.

Commercial "production grade support" for the entire technology stack - from hardware and hypervisor to Kubernetes and related open software from De Novo and VMware. De Novo is a member of the Cloud Native Computing Foundation (CNCF) association and, as proof of its high level of expertise in Kubernetes technologies, is a Kubernetes Certified Service Provider.
